Common questions about chevrolet repair services in Newbern, TN
In Newbern, common issues include air conditioning system failures due to our hot, humid summers and brake component wear from frequent stop-and-go driving on Highway 51 and county roads. For trucks and SUVs like the Silverado or Tahoe, we also frequently see suspension and 4WD system concerns from use on local farm and rural properties.
Look for a shop with GM/Chevrolet-specific diagnostic tools and certified technicians, as general mechanics may lack the latest software for complex systems. In the Newbern/Dyersburg area, check for shops with strong local reputations built over many years, and don't hesitate to ask for references from other Chevy owners at local gathering spots.

Labor rates in Newbern are typically more competitive than in major metropolitan areas, which can lower overall repair costs. However, parts pricing is largely consistent, and some specialized parts may need to be ordered, causing a short delay similar to any regional location.
The flat terrain and seasonal temperature extremes mean you should pay close attention to your cooling system, battery, and tire pressure. Additionally, if you frequently drive on gravel roads or uneven farmland common in Dyer County, consider more frequent inspections of your suspension, steering, and undercarriage for wear.
